Skip to content

Commit c7eac44

Browse files
committed
fix: color ramps with one element now work
1 parent 7bd12ec commit c7eac44

File tree

1 file changed

+3
-1
lines changed

1 file changed

+3
-1
lines changed

utils.py

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-290,9 +290,11 @@ def color_ramp_settings(node, file: TextIO, inner: str, node_var: str):
290290
file.write("\n")
291291

292292
#key points
293+
file.write((f"{inner}{node_var}.color_ramp.elements.remove"
294+
f"({node_var}.color_ramp.elements[0])\n"))
293295
for i, element in enumerate(color_ramp.elements):
294296
element_var = f"{node_var}_cre_{i}"
295-
if i < 2:
297+
if i == 0:
296298
file.write(f"{inner}{element_var} = "
297299
f"{node_var}.color_ramp.elements[{i}]\n")
298300
file.write(f"{inner}{element_var}.position = {element.position}\n")

0 commit comments

Comments
 (0)